Properly Enabling
Cookies on INTERNET EXPLORER 5 and 6:
- In Internet Explorer click on
"Tools" at the top of the window.
- Select "Internet Options".
- Click on the "Privacy" tab.
- Click on the "Advanced" button
- Ensure that "Override automatic
cookie handling" is checked.
- First and Third party cookies
should be set to "Accept"
- Check "Always allow session
cookies"
- Click on "OK"
- Click "Apply" and then "OK"
- Exit Internet Explorer and restart
your computer

Clear Cache In
EXPLORER:
- Click on INTERNET OPTIONS, which
is either under VIEW or TOOLS, depending on Explorer Version.
(Version 4 under VIEW and version 5 under TOOLS)
- Click on DELETE FILES under
the Temporary Internet File Category (in the General tab). Click
OK.
- Click OK again to exit.
